    FISH4ACP Senegal
    Unlocking the potential of oyster production in Senegal
    2021
    Also available in:

    FISH4ACP, an initiative of the African, Caribbean and Pacific Group of States (OACPS) that aims to improves the economic, social and environmental sustainability of fisheries and aquaculture value chains in Africa, the Caribbean and the Pacific, aims to stimulate sustainable growth of the oyster sector in Senegal. Oysters are a vital source of healthy food for many people in Senegal. They also generate significant revenues for women, particularly in the south of the country. FISH4ACP works with them to increase their incomes and improve working conditions, while reducing the pressure of oyster harvesting on Senegal’s mangroves. FISH4CP is implemented by FAO with funding from the European Union and the German Federal Ministry for Economic Cooperation and Development (BMZ).
